Argonne scientists to control attractive force for nanoelectromechanical systems
Dec 10, 2009 |
3 / 5 (2) |
1
Scientists at the U.S. Department of Energy's Argonne National Laboratory are developing a way to control the Casimir force, a quantum mechanical force, which attracts objects when they are only hundred nanometers apart.

Nanoparticle protects oil in foods from oxidation, spoilage
Nanotechnology / Nanomaterials
Dec 08, 2009 |
3 / 5 (3) |
0
(PhysOrg.com) -- Using a nanoparticle from corn, a Purdue University scientist has found a way to lengthen the shelf life of many food products and sustain their health benefits.
